126 // Malloc validation is a scheme whereby a tag is attached to an
127 // allocation which identifies how it was originally allocated.
128 // This allows us to verify that the freeing operation matches the
129 // allocation operation. If memory is allocated with operator new[]
130 // but freed with free or delete, this system would detect that.
131 // In the implementation here, the tag is an integer prepended to
132 // the allocation memory which is assigned one of the AllocType
133 // enumeration values. An alternative implementation of this
134 // scheme could store the tag somewhere else or ignore it.
135 // Users of FastMalloc don't need to know or care how this tagging
